Output 7ebaacb6893252f93d0db722c0fb59bd8f48bc3ba5301bb053fc7504c0bae2c8:106

value
19519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b3daeec5dec9c79c8b281b8e5bdcc2c7a45924 OP_EQUAL
address
3Qum1pwqxSCKQfzhvmfUZ2QaCCRegEFcVV
transaction
7ebaacb6893252f93d0db722c0fb59bd8f48bc3ba5301bb053fc7504c0bae2c8
confirmations
155462
spent
true